Programme Overview
This course is designed for software developers, quality assurance engineers, and technical leads who need to enhance their skills in reviewing and improving Python code quality. Participants will learn to use static analysis tools to identify and fix bugs, improve code readability, and ensure compliance with coding standards.
By the end of the course, attendees will be proficient in integrating static analysis into their development processes, significantly reducing bugs and improving software quality. They will also gain hands-on experience with popular tools like PyLint, Flake8, and Bandit, equipping them to lead code reviews and mentor junior developers in best coding practices.

Topics Covered
- 1. Introduction to Static Analysis Tools: Learners will study the basics of static analysis tools and their importance in Python code review. They will gain foundational knowledge about how these tools work and their role in identifying potential issues in code without executing it.
- 2. Python Code Structure and Semantics: This module covers the fundamental structure and semantics of Python code, essential for understanding how static analysis tools interpret and analyze code.
- 3. Static Analysis Fundamentals: Learners will delve into the principles of static analysis, including type checking, path analysis, and control flow analysis, using Python as the primary context.
- 4. Common Python Code Issues and Fixes: This module focuses on identifying and resolving common issues found in Python code using static analysis tools, enhancing learners' ability to write cleaner and more maintainable code.
- 5. Static Analysis Tools for Python: An in-depth look at various static analysis tools available for Python, including their features, strengths, and limitations. Learners will practice using these tools on real-world codebases.
- 6. Advanced Static Analysis Techniques: Learners will explore advanced techniques such as data flow analysis, symbolic execution, and machine learning-based approaches to static analysis, expanding their toolkit for thorough code reviews.
- 7. Integration of Static Analysis into Development Workflow: This module teaches how to integrate static analysis tools into the software development lifecycle, improving code quality and reducing bugs before deployment.
- 8. Writing and Contributing to Static Analysis Tools: Learners will learn how to develop their own static analysis tools or contribute to existing ones, gaining a deeper understanding of tool design and implementation.
- 9. Security Analysis with Static Tools: This module covers the use of static analysis tools to identify security vulnerabilities in Python code, equipping learners with tools and knowledge to enhance software security.
- 10. Case Studies and Best Practices: Through case studies and best practices, learners will apply their knowledge and skills to real-world scenarios, solidifying their understanding of how to effectively use static analysis tools in professional settings.
